Key Steps to Launching a Reseller Hosting Business
1. Define Your Niche
Instead of competing head‑to‑head with global giants, focus on a specific audience: local small businesses, creative studios, or niche e‑commerce platforms. This strategy reduces marketing friction and builds a loyal customer base.
2. Secure Reliable Infrastructure
Partner with a data center that offers redundant power, climate control, and 99.99% uptime guarantees. Consider Icelandic data centers that leverage geothermal cooling for energy efficiency—an eco‑friendly selling point for clients.
3. Build a Robust Technical Stack
Choose a control panel that is easy to use for both you and your customers. Popular options include cPanel, Plesk, and the open‑source Webmin/Virtualmin. Ensure your stack supports automation tools like WHMCS for billing and ticketing.
4. Develop a Pricing Model
Competitive pricing is essential. Offer tiered packages that scale with bandwidth, storage, and support levels. Add value with features such as free SSL certificates, daily backups, and one‑click CMS installations.
5. Implement Strong Security Protocols
Security is non‑negotiable. Deploy DDoS protection, regular patch management, and multi‑factor authentication for your control panel. Communicate these measures to clients to build trust.
Choosing the Right Platform & Tools
Beyond the hosting hardware, the success of your reseller business hinges on software that simplifies management and enhances customer experience. Below are essential tools:
- WHMCS – Automates billing, support, and domain registration.
- cPanel/WHM – User‑friendly control panel for end‑users.
- Let's Encrypt – Free SSL certificates to secure every site.
- Cloudflare – CDN and DDoS mitigation for global reach.
- Mailgun or Postfix – Reliable email delivery for newsletters and notifications.
